List the various marketing promotion schemes run by the Ministry of MSME.

 Here are some of the prominent marketing promotion schemes run by the Ministry of MSME:

  1. Market Development Assistance (MDA) Scheme: The MDA scheme aims to provide financial assistance to MSMEs for participating in domestic and international trade fairs, exhibitions, buyer-seller meets, and marketing events. The scheme helps MSMEs showcase their products, build business contacts, and explore new markets. Financial assistance is provided for expenses such as stall rent, display materials, and travel expenses.
  2. International Cooperation (IC) Scheme: This scheme focuses on promoting international cooperation among MSMEs. It supports activities such as exchange of business delegations, joint ventures, technology transfers, and collaborations with foreign enterprises. By facilitating global partnerships, MSMEs can access new markets, technologies, and expertise.
  3. National Manufacturing Competitiveness Programme (NMCP): Under the NMCP, there are various components aimed at enhancing the competitiveness of MSMEs, including marketing support. The "Building Awareness on Intellectual Property Rights (IPR)" component helps MSMEs protect their intellectual property, which is essential for branding and marketing.
  4. Credit Linked Capital Subsidy Scheme (CLCSS): While not a marketing promotion scheme directly, the CLCSS offers capital subsidy to MSMEs for upgrading their technology and machinery. Upgraded technology can lead to improved product quality and efficiency, which in turn can positively impact marketing efforts.
  5. Design Clinic Scheme for Design Expertise to MSMEs: Design plays a critical role in product differentiation and marketing. This scheme provides design expertise and support to MSMEs to improve the design and aesthetics of their products, making them more appealing to customers.
  6. Support for Entrepreneurial and Managerial Development of SMEs through Incubators: Incubators play a significant role in nurturing startups and early-stage MSMEs. While not solely focused on marketing, incubators provide mentoring, training, and networking opportunities that can help MSMEs refine their marketing strategies.
  7. Quality Management Standards & Quality Technology Tools (QMS-QTT): Quality management and adherence to standards are crucial for establishing a positive brand image and gaining customer trust. This scheme helps MSMEs adopt quality management systems and technologies that enhance product quality and competitiveness.
  8. Lean Manufacturing Competitiveness Scheme for MSMEs: Lean manufacturing focuses on reducing waste and improving efficiency. Implementing lean principles can lead to cost savings and better product offerings, making MSMEs more competitive in the market.
  9. Zero Defect Zero Effect (ZED) Certification Scheme: The ZED scheme encourages MSMEs to adopt zero-defect manufacturing processes while minimizing their environmental impact. This certification can enhance a company's reputation and marketing positioning as a quality-conscious and environmentally responsible entity.
  10. Procurement and Marketing Support Scheme for MSMEs: This scheme focuses on improving the marketing capabilities of MSMEs through various interventions, such as vendor development programs, buyer-seller meets, and marketing campaigns. It aims to connect MSMEs with larger enterprises and government procurement agencies.
  11. Marketing Assistance Scheme for MSMEs: This scheme provides support to MSMEs for enhancing their marketing efforts through activities like market surveys, branding, packaging, and marketing studies. The goal is to help MSMEs better understand market trends and customer preferences.
  12. Digital MSME Scheme: Digital marketing is becoming increasingly important. This scheme aims to promote the adoption of digital technologies and e-commerce platforms among MSMEs, enabling them to reach a wider customer base and expand their market presence.
